My friend and I's CoOp campaign has desynced and seems impossible to load up again (and right when the campaign was getting REALLY good). My friend is hosting the campaign, and as the game loads it just drops out for him and returns to the game lobby, whereas my computer loads the game only to come up with the msg 'game aborted'.
I am playing as the Saxons and he is playing as the Franks. The desync has occurred at turn 113.
We're both on broadband, I have a wireless modem, he is using a DSL connected to his router.

First ,download EditSF 1.1.1
http://sourceforge.net/projects/pack...1.zip/download
Then,use it open the path
C:\Users\User(or your user name)\AppData\Roaming\The Creative Assembly\Attila\save_games_multiplayer
Find your latest save,then open it.
Then find any integer "101" ,change it to whatever you want ,which must be smaller than 100
Attachment 28589
in this catalog and multiplayer ,COMPRESSED DATA -multiplayer ,COMPRESSED DATA -SAVE_GAME_HEADER_MULTIPLAYER, and ,COMPRESSED DATA -CAMPAIGN_ENV_CAMPAIGN_CALENDAR
Attachment 28590
For example ,i change 101 to 61
Then click save, then copy the autosave.save_multiplayer to your partner's computer,then cover the same catalog
(C:\Users\User\AppData\Roaming\The Creative Assembly\Attila\save_games_multiplayer)
Then you can play again ! (until it reach 101 turns again ....then ,you know what to do ..)
This change won't affact anything in the game, it didn't have anything to do with the years and the historial event~~
